Citi Reiterates Sell Rating on XPeng (XPEV), 'may never be able to break even'
January 17, 2023 12:34 PM ESTCiti analyst Jeff Chung reiterated a Sell rating and $8.92 price target on XPeng (NYSE: XPEV).
The analyst comments "Assuming lithium carbonate cost drops by Rmb300k/ton, G9s GPM at 20% and quarterly sales of G3i/P5/P7/G9 at 3.6k/6k/18k/18k, we estimate Xpengs blended vehicle GPM at around 11% after price cut, with GPM of G3i/P5/P7 alone close to 0%,... More
